Kami was founded in 2013 by four university friends (although the team has grown a bit since). We are one of the fastest-growing education technology companies. Kami has millions of users worldwide and Kami Heroes – a community of passionate teachers across the Americas, Europe, and Asia. Kami is also a finalist for New Zealand Innovator of the Year.
The investors backing Kami include leading Australian venture capitalist firm Right Click Capital, CapitalPitch, New Zealand-based Flying Kiwi Angels, New Zealand Venture Investment Fund, and notable Silicon Valley investors, such as Sam Altman of Y Combinator and Scott Nolan of Founders Fund. As a Premier Google Partner, Kami works instantly through seamless integration with G Suite apps, like Google Drive and Google Classroom, as well other educational programs like Canvas and Schoology.
